- ¿Cómo me ejecuto como usuario de sudo ansible??
- ¿Ansible se ejecuta como root??
- ¿Cómo ejecuto un comando como root en Ansible??
- Cómo agregar sudo en Ansible?
- ¿Cómo sudo como usuario root??
- ¿Puede Ansible ejecutar scripts??
- ¿Cómo ejecuto un comando como root en Bash??
- ¿Cómo ejecuto un archivo como root en la terminal??
- ¿Es la infraestructura Ansible como código??
- ¿Es el procedimiento o declarativo anhelado??
- ¿Cuál es la desventaja de Ansible??
- ¿Podemos usar Ansible como IAC??
¿Cómo me ejecuto como usuario de sudo ansible??
Ansible sudo o convertirse es un método para ejecutar una tarea particular en un libro de jugadas con privilegios especiales como el usuario root o algún otro usuario. convertirse y convertirse en_user deben usarse en un libro de jugadas en ciertos casos en los que desea que su usuario remoto no sea raíz.Es más como hacer sudo -u Someuser antes de ejecutar una tarea.
¿Ansible se ejecuta como root??
Ansible utiliza sistemas de escalada de privilegios existentes para ejecutar tareas con privilegios raíz o con permisos de otro usuario. Debido a que esta característica le permite 'convertirse' en otro usuario, diferente del usuario que inició sesión en la máquina (usuario remoto), lo llamamos convertirse en .
¿Cómo ejecuto un comando como root en Ansible??
Para ejecutar un comando específico como el usuario raíz en Ansible, puede implementar la directiva Being y establecer el valor en 'Verdadero. 'Hacer esto le dice a Ansible que implementa sudo sin argumentos al ejecutar el comando.
Cómo agregar sudo en Ansible?
Crear un usuario con privilegios de sudo es poner al usuario en /etc /sudoers, o hacer del usuario un miembro de un grupo especificado en /etc /sudoers . Y para que sea sin contraseña es especificar adicionalmente nopasswd en /etc /sudoers . Y en lugar de jugar con el archivo /etc /sudoers, podemos crear un nuevo archivo en /etc /sudoers.
¿Cómo sudo como usuario root??
Al usar sudo, debe usar el parámetro "-i". Por lo tanto, iniciaría sesión como su usuario no privilegiado y luego ejecutaría "sudo -i", no "sudo -s". Que le da a su usuario raíz el entorno raíz.
¿Puede Ansible ejecutar scripts??
ansible. incorporado. Módulo de script: ejecuta un script local en un nodo remoto después de transferirlo - documentación ansible. Continuar construyendo sobre su conocimiento de automatización, visite el Hub de contenido AnsibleFest!
¿Cómo ejecuto un comando como root en Bash??
Para dar privilegios raíz a un usuario al ejecutar un script de shell, podemos usar el comando sudo bash con el shebang. Esto ejecutará el script de shell como usuario root. Ejemplo: #!/usr/bin/sudo bash ....
¿Cómo ejecuto un archivo como root en la terminal??
Habilitar la cuenta raíz
Inicie una ventana de terminal presionando el Ctrl + Alt + T o Ctrl + Shift + T en el teclado. Luego, suponiendo que su sistema tenga privilegios de sudo, use el comando sudo -s para iniciar sesión en una sesión elevada.
¿Es la infraestructura Ansible como código??
Ansible es una infraestructura de código abierto como una herramienta de código compatible con Redhat. Se utiliza para manejar múltiples configuraciones y administración del servidor desde un punto. Ayuda a automatizar la configuración de múltiples servidores a la vez, en lugar de conectarse a un servidor individual y luego a llevar a cabo su tarea deseada.
¿Es el procedimiento o declarativo anhelado??
Ansible es una herramienta de administración de configuración. Sigue una infraestructura declarativa como enfoque de código. Sigue un enfoque de procedimiento. Es el mejor ajuste para orquestar servicios en la nube y configurar la infraestructura en la nube desde cero.
¿Cuál es la desventaja de Ansible??
Las desventajas de Ansible incluyen la depuración, el rendimiento, las estructuras de datos complejas y el flujo de control. Estructuras de datos complejas. Muchas tareas de automatización de red requieren estructuras de datos complejas. Una de las primeras cosas que consideré al aprender Ansible fue usarlo para realizar el descubrimiento de la red.
¿Podemos usar Ansible como IAC??
Terraform y Ansible son dos herramientas IAC principales que ayudan a las empresas a crear configuraciones y escalarlas fácilmente. Ambas herramientas actúan como plataformas de nivel avanzado en la implementación de aplicaciones complejas.